Admission Snapshot
Typical admitted student: A bachelor's degree in computer science, engineering, or a related field with a minimum GPA of 3.0 is required; relevant programming experience or prerequisites in data structures and algorithms may be needed.
About This Program
This 12-credit graduate program is designed for working professionals seeking to gain a competitive edge in artificial intelligence and machine learning.

What You'll Learn
- Core principles of artificial intelligence algorithms and systems
- Machine learning techniques for predictive modeling and pattern recognition
- Implementation of deep learning models for complex data processing
- Natural language processing for text analysis and generation
Curriculum Highlights
The curriculum features coursework in artificial intelligence foundations, machine learning techniques, and specialized topics like deep learning or AI robotics.

Application Materials
- Statement of Purpose: Required
- Letters of Recommendation: 2β3
- Resume: Required
- Transcripts: Official transcripts required
Academic Requirements
- Degree Required: Bachelor's degree
- GRE/GMAT: Not Required
- TOEFL/IELTS: Required for international students (TOEFL 80+ / IELTS 6.5+)
